泉缘泉 发表于 2024-12-22 00:05:00

文心一言对接FreeSWITCH实现大模型呼唤中心

文心一言对接FreeSWITCH实现大模型呼唤中心

作者:开源大模型智能呼唤中心FreeIPCC,Github:https://github.com/lihaiya/freeipcc
随着人工智能技术的快速发展,特别是大规模语言模型(LLM)的应用,构建智能呼唤中心体系变得更加高效和灵活。百度的文心一言作为一款强大的预训练语言模型,结合开源通信平台FreeSWITCH,可以创建一个高度智能化、响应敏捷且易于扩展的呼唤中心解决方案。本文将具体先容怎样使用文心一言与FreeSWITCH集成,打造一个现代化的大模型呼唤中心,并探究其优势、应用场景及实施步调。
一、文心一言简介

文心一言是百度开发的大规模语言模型,具备优秀的自然语言处理本领,支持文本生成、问答对话、择要提取等多种任务。它不仅拥有丰富的知识储备,还能根据上下文灵活调解答复策略,适用于各种复杂场景下的自动化交流。此外,文心一言在中文理解和生成方面具有独特的优势,非常适合面向中国市场的客户服务应用。
二、FreeSWITCH概述

FreeSWITCH是一个开源的多媒体通信服务器,提供了包罗VoIP通话、即时消息传递在内的多种通信服务。它的模块化计划答应开发者根据实际需求定制功能,广泛应用于企业级通信体系中。通过集成文心一言,FreeSWITCH能够实现更智能的客户服务体验,提供更加个性化和高效的交互方式。
三、实现方案

1. 情况准备



[*]硬件资源:确保有足够的计算资源来支持整个体系的运行,包罗但不限于CPU/GPU、内存、存储空间和网络带宽。
[*]操作体系:保举使用Linux发行版Ubuntu或CentOS,由于它们对FreeSWITCH的支持较好,同时也能满足大多数LLM框架的需求。
[*]网络设置:保证网络毗连稳固且带宽富足,特别是对于语音通信来说,低延长和高可靠性至关重要。
2. 安装与设置FreeSWITCH

按照官方指南安装FreeSWITCH,并完成基础设置。这包罗:


[*]设置SIP账户
[*]定义IVR菜单
[*]设置灌音功能
[*]确保全部组件正常工作并与现有IT基础设施无缝集成
3. 摆设文心一言API接口



[*]选择摆设方式:可以通过百度提供的API直接调用文心一言的服务,或者下载本地版本举行私有化摆设。
[*]编写API接口:创建RESTful API接口,答应FreeSWITCH以HTTP哀求的形式将用户的语音转换为文本,并传递给文心一言举行处理。随后,文心一言生成的回复也会通过同样的API返回给FreeSWITCH,再由后者转换回语音播放给用户。
4. 构建对话引擎

为了使交互更加流畅自然,需要开发一个对话管理体系。它负责:


[*]跟踪对话状态
[*]理解上下文信息
[*]根据需要调解答复策略
[*]处理异常情况,如超时重试、错误规复等
5. 测试与优化

在正式上线之前,必须经过严格的测试阶段,验证各个组件之间的兼容性和整体性能体现。网络用户反馈,不断调解参数,直至到达满足的用户体验为止。
四、应用场景



[*]自动应答与转接:当客户拨打进来时,智能客服可以根据他们的提问敏捷给出答案或者引导至正确的部门。这种方式不仅进步了效率,也淘汰了等待时间。
[*]个性化保举:基于汗青数据的学习,机器人可以在适当的时间为客户保举相关产品或服务,增长销售机会。
[*]多轮对话处理:对于复杂的问题,机器人能够保持长时间的会话,逐步引导客户解决问题,而无需人工干预。
[*]情绪分析与响应:检测客户的情绪变革,适时调解沟透风格,好比当检测到不满情绪时,立即转接给真人客服或提供特别优惠。
[*]数据分析与陈诉:定期生成具体的通话记录和统计报表,帮助企业相识业务趋势和服务质量。
五、技术细节:怎样实现文心一言与FreeSWITCH的深度整合

1. API接口计划

创建RESTful API接口,答应FreeSWITCH以HTTP哀求的形式将客户的语音转换为文本,并传递给文心一言举行处理。随后,文心一言生成的回复也会通过同样的API返回给FreeSWITCH,再由后者转换回语音播放给客户。
2. 语音识别与合成

为了实现从语音到文本再到语音的完备闭环,需引入高质量的ASR(Automatic Speech Recognition)和TTS(Text-to-Speech)服务。这些服务可以通过第三方API(如Google Cloud Speech-to-Text和Amazon Polly)获得,也可以使用开源项目(如Kaldi和eSpeak)自行搭建。
3. 对话管理

计划一个中心化的对话管理器,用于协调FreeSWITCH与文心一言之间的交互。该管理器应能够维护每个会话的状态,跟踪对话进展,并根据上下文动态调解答复策略。此外,还需思量异常处理逻辑,如超时重试、错误规复等。
4. 数据安全与隐私掩护

思量到涉及敏感个人信息的安全性,必须接纳严格的数据加密措施,确保传输过程中的信息安全。服从相关的法律法规(如GDPR),采用匿名化处理和个人信息掩护机制,保障用户的隐私权益。
六、面临的挑衅



[*]隐私掩护:处理敏感个人信息时要严格服从法律法规,如GDPR。采用加密技术和匿名化处理可帮助缓解此问题。
[*]错误率控制:纵然是最先进的模型也可能犯错。建立有效的监控和纠错机制,如人工审核和自动更新规则,有助于维持高程度的服务。
[*]成本效益均衡:虽然开源软件低落了初期投入,但在后期维护和技术支持方面仍需思量成本。优化算法结构和选择合适的云服务提供商可以低落总体开支。
[*]持续学习与改进:保持体系的最新状态非常重要,这意味着要定期更新模型和算法,以应对不断变革的客户需求和技术进步。
七、进步语音识别和合成正确性

为了确保语音识别(ASR)和语音合成(TTS)的正确性,可以从以下几个方面举行优化:
提升ASR正确性



[*]高质量音频输入:使用高保真麦克风,降噪处理,回声消除。
[*]优化语言模型与声学模型:定制化训练数据,混合模型,持续更新。
[*]上下文感知与多轮对话支持:汗青对话记录分析,意图识别。
[*]实时反馈与自顺应调解:用户校正机制,动态调解参数。
进步TTS自然度与正确性



[*]选择合适的TTS引擎:评估现有解决方案,思量音质、语速、情绪表达等因素。
[*]个性化声音设置:多脚色发音,情绪模拟。
[*]文本预处理与后处理:格式转换,韵律控制。
[*]多语言与方言支持:多语言库,本地化调解。
八、综合措施

集成测试与验证



[*]单元测试:开发针对ASR和TTS各个功能模块的小规模测试用例。
[*]集成测试:模拟真实天下的复杂场景,测试整个体系的协同工作本领。
[*]A/B测试:尝试不同的对话流程或答复模板,逐步推广最佳实践。
持续监控与反馈循环



[*]性能指标跟踪:设定关键性能指标(KPIs),持续观察这些数据的变革趋势。
[*]用户满足度观察:每次交互竣事后扣问用户对其服务体验的见解。
[*]问题追踪体系:建立专门的问题陈诉渠道,便于后续跟进解决。
技术支持与培训



[*]专业团队维护:组建熟悉ASR和TTS技术的专业团队。
[*]员工培训计划:定期构造内部培训课程,传授最新技术和最佳实践。
结论

通过整合文心一言与FreeSWITCH,企业不仅可以构建出一个灵活、高效的智能呼唤中心体系,还能显著提升客户服务体验。这种方法不仅节省了成本,还促进了技术创新和发展。随着更多企业和开发者加入到这个生态体系中,我们可以期待看到更多新颖的应用案例出现,进一步推动行业向前发展。

免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!更多信息从访问主页:qidao123.com:ToB企服之家,中国第一个企服评测及商务社交产业平台。
页: [1]
查看完整版本: 文心一言对接FreeSWITCH实现大模型呼唤中心